Idaho police chiefs gather for annual conference; pre-set agenda already included how to deal with a mass shooting…
How to deal with a mass shooting was an agenda topic that was set months ago for the fall conference of the Idaho Chiefs of Police Association, which kicked off today in Twin Falls, KBOI2 News reports; the Idaho chiefs were saddened to start off their conference with the news of the Las Vegas shooting. “I think our collective reaction is one of sadness and sorrow,” Twin Falls Police Chief Craig Kingsbury told KBOI2’s Scott Logan. “As police chiefs, we need to make sure our agencies are as prepared as possible to react and to respond to such an incident.” Logan’s full report is online here.
The police chiefs’ conference agenda also includes sessions on victims’ rights, pre-trial release, body cameras and more.
